Schools Done; So, What’s Cooking on the Job Front?

by:Amanda Shoemake

You've finally done it! You've cooked, baked and sautéed your way through weeks of school. Congratulations!

But, now what? What should you do with the wonderful degree you have recently acquired? Culinary school has prepped and primed you to enter a world full of flavors, scents and techniques, but have you given any thought to where you want to work?

When it comes to food-related jobs you'll find that the culinary job market is just as diverse as the recipes in a cookbook. But, how do you know which one to choose? Fear not my fellow gastronomist, there are simple ways to narrow down your choices.

Ask yourself: Do you see yourself in a fast-paced kitchen? Perhaps your more fond of teaching others? Or, maybe you see yourself as a food stylist? Maybe you want to be in charge of your own kitchen? Or, perhaps you are interested in writing about food? Think about what setting would fulfill your culinary desires.

With all that goes on in the culinary world, there is that perfect job that reflects your personal style and will allow you to expand on your newly acquired knowledge. Whether you choose to work in a restaurant, cater functions or assist people there is bound to be something that will wet your palate.

Luckily, when it comes to food the sky is the limit. With jobs ranging from the application of cooking to the science of making a great recipe, there is always going to be something new to explore.
